Looking to upsell Walt Disney World vacation packages? Start by understanding what motivates your clients. Listen to their needs and what they value most in a trip. Suggest options that enhance their experience and ease their concerns. For example, if they worry about long lines, offer a quote with Lightning Lanes or resorts with shorter transportation waits. Don’t push extras just to raise the price. Use smart travel insights and proven techniques to guide your recommendations.
